Abstract

A disease diagnosis system including a processor and a storage device for storing a neural network and using a biometric image and the neural network, the disease diagnosis system including a micro-neural network for receiving a first tile included in the biometric image through a first input layer, and including a plurality of first layers and an output layer, and a macro-neural network for receiving a macro-tile including the first tile and at least one or more second tiles adjacent to the first tile through a second input layer, and including a plurality of second layers and the output layer, in which the output layer includes at least one state channel indicating a state of a disease of a biological tissue corresponding to the first tile.
